This page summarises the proposed uplift for legacy-tier customers of the Quorlane platform, prepared for board review. Contracts signed before the Meridale migration remain 18–22% below current list rates, and support costs for these accounts have risen steadily. We propose a phased increase over three quarters, with notice periods honoured in full and retention offers reserved for the top fifty accounts by revenue. Churn modelling suggests exposure is manageable. The confidential rationale follows below.

confidential, kagep-kahof: Druokax Systems plans to lower the Ulaath list price by 53 percent in March.

Handover for eng sync: I've updated the canary gating rules for the Brindlewood deploy pipeline. Error-rate threshold is now 0.5% over a ten-minute window, and latency p99 regression beyond 15% triggers automatic rollback. Rules live in the gating config repo; changes require two approvals. Ongoing ownership of the gating ruleset transfers to the person listed below.

account owner for fajep-yagef: Kasix Eliiel

# Env Vars — Findrel Search Relevance Tuning

Relevance knobs live in the ranker env file. FINDREL_TITLE_BOOST and FINDREL_RECENCY_DECAY are the only vars safe to change between releases. Everything else requires a reindex. Changes take effect on ranker restart; no deploy needed. The ranker pulls tuning profiles from the config service, authenticating with a token set on the line immediately below.

vault entry, hafog-kajeg: LEDGER_TOKEN5=f15b0

## Configuration

The Cartwheel pick-list optimizer reads all settings from the environment; nothing is baked into the image. `OPTIMIZER_MODE` selects the routing heuristic, `ZONE_MAP_PATH` points to the warehouse layout file, and `MAX_PICKS_PER_RUN` bounds batch size. All values are validated at startup and the process exits on malformed input, which limits injection surface. Config is never written back to disk. The optimizer authenticates to the inventory service with a secret set on the next line.

sealed setting: ARCHIVE_KEY3=8d0